Menu
HOME
Arcade
Puzzles
Dress-Up
Action Games
Adventure
Other
Racing Games
Search
CLICK TO START!
Drift Race 3D
Tap to turn right, and release to turn left and stay on the endless road, drift your way to the finish line, beat the other players and be the drift king, the best racer.
Close
Login
Username or Email Address
Password
Remember Me